About MSc in Architectural Conservation and Design at The Chinese University of Hong Kong

Architectural conservation is increasingly an important area of work for architects and architectural conservationists in Hong Kong and the region. With increased awareness of the value of architectural heritage, the society looks to proper and careful interpretation, conservation and reuse of historic buildings in cities and countryside. In Hong Kong, the number of conservation projects, led both by the government and the private sector, has mushroomed over the last 5 years. In this context, the programme places emphasis on professionalism in approaching the conservation of and design with historic buildings, learning from and with international professionals.

The programme will establish educational partnership with leading universities in the world on conservation education, as well as leading institution in China, in teaching and student exchange. Experienced practitioners will also be invited to offer courses and lectures at the programme.

Entry requirements

The Master of Science in Architectural Conservation and Design Programme is organized as a self-financed programme of the Graduate School at The Chinese University of Hong Kong. The tuition fee is $110,000 for 2014-15 (12month). The places for the programme are given based on the academic and professional merit of the application.
